Renting an Apartment in Belle Glade
Belle Glade is a city in Palm Beach County, Florida on the southeastern shore
of Lake Okeechobee. The population was 14,906 at the 2000 census. According to
the U.S Census estimates of 2005, the city had a population of 15,423.
For a time, the city had the highest rate of AIDS infection in the United
States. About half the sugarcane in the nation is grown in the plains around
Belle Glade and nearby Clewiston. According to the FBI in 2003 the city had the
second highest violent crime rate in the country at 298 per 10,000 residents.
Demographics
There were 4,854 households out of which 39.0% had children under the age of 18
living with them, 40.9% were married couples living together, 22.0% had a female
householder with no husband present, and 29.3% were non-families. 23.3% of all
households were made up of individuals and 6.1% had someone living alone who was
65 years of age or older. The average household size was 3.04 and the average
family size was 3.62.
In the city the population was spread out with 33.5% under the age of 18, 10.0%
from 18 to 24, 27.1% from 25 to 44, 20.7% from 45 to 64, and 8.7% who were 65
years of age or older. The median age was 30 years. For every 100 females there
were 103.5 males. For every 100 females age 18 and over, there were 102.6 males.
The median income for a household in the city was $22,715, and the median income
for a family was $26,756. Males had a median income of $26,232 versus $21,410
for females. The per capita income for the city was $11,159. About 28.5% of
families and 32.9% of the population were below the poverty line, including
41.1% of those under age 18 and 21.4% of those age 65 or over.
Schools
Belle Glade has a history of struggling schools, with students at both ends of
the educational spectrum. However in 2006 all of Belle Glade's public schools
except Glades Central Community High School, received an FCAT grade of "C" or
better, from the Florida Dept. of Education Glades Central received a grade of
"D".
Trivia
* Belle Glade (and the surrounding area) is sometimes referred to as "Muck City"
due to the large quantity of muck (soil), in which sugarcane grows, found in the
area.
* Belle Glade is home to Glades Central Community High School, which is
consistently ranked among the top high school football teams in the state of
Florida and the United States. Glades Central High School also has the largest
number of football players currently in the NFL than any high School in Florida.
* Because of its great football team Glades Central Community High School's
band, the Marching Maroon Machine Band, has performed at more football games
than any other school in the state of Florida since 1971.
* The football game against rival team Pahokee High School, "Blue Devils" is one
of the largest high school rivalry games in the country, drawing almost 8,000
spectators each year.
